Sad Song #14 -- "Julie's Song" by Joel Hanson
This is the song about a woman named Julie Steiskal. She lived her life with conviction and had a knack for loving those around her with genuine unconditional love. Julie tried to save a girl who slipped and fell into a river. Refusing to let go of her hand in her attempt to save the girl, both of them were swept over some falls to their ultimate death. It prompts the question -- can a person be classified a hero in a failed attempt at heroism? I say the answer is yes, because the ability to look past oneself and risk the possibility of death for someone else is heroic in and of itself. But the outcome was still so sad, so very sad.
